Center for Monitoring and Research (CEMI) in partnership with the Center for Democracy and Human Rights (CEDEM) and the Network for the Affirmation of European Integration Processes (MAEIP) within the framework of the project “Judicial Reform: Improving the capacity of civil society organizations in contributing to the preservation of the integrity of the judiciary”, funded by the European Union, through the Pre-Accession Assistance Program (IPA) and the Ministry of Public Administration has announced a call for granting small grants to non-governmental organizations with the aim of supporting the achievement of a higher level of democracy and the rule of law in Montenegro. The amount of funding that can be approved for individual projects will range from EUR 5,000 to EUR 8,000. The proposed projects can take up to 6 months. Read more here.
